http://static.aapc.com/a3c7c3fe-6fa1-4d67-8534-a3c9c8315fa0/cfa2b133-ce13-47e1-90c1-4907eba70dbd/5e741e3e-80a9-40c1-9857-d0b90fe5866c.pdf WebOct 15, 2024 · Normally for a right colectomy, we would use 44160 and the use 44310 for creation of an ileostomy However, 44160 states that an anastomosis is performed. With an end ileostomy, no anastomosis is performed. Also, this is a Medicare patient, so the use of the 52 modifier (reduced services) with 44160 will be denied.

WebMay 29, 2024 · In an open procedure, the ileostomy creation is typically the last step. In a minimally invasive main procedure, the bowel loop for the ileostomy should be prepared prior to losing the pneumoperitoneum. WebJan 21, 2024 · What is the CPT code for end colostomy? You should report CPT code 44146 (see Table 1). Although the CPT descriptor includes the term “colostomy,” the Medicare physician fee schedule work relative value unit (RVU) for this code is based on creation of either a colostomy or an ileostomy. cliff590 4x4
